What Are Multi Color Abstract Pattern Papers?
Multi color abstract pattern papers are digital files designed with complex, artistic patterns that blend multiple colors in an abstract style. Unlike traditional solid-colored paper, these designs feature dynamic compositions that can add depth, interest, and visual appeal to any project. They are typically created using graphic design software and exported as high-resolution image files, making them ideal for both print and digital use.
The term "abstract" refers to the non-representational nature of the designs—these are not realistic images but rather stylized, geometric, or freeform patterns. This makes them highly adaptable to various creative applications, from card making to web design.

How to Use Multi Color Abstract Pattern Papers
Using these papers is straightforward, but understanding how to integrate them into your projects can significantly enhance the final result. Here are some practical tips:
1. Choose the Right Paper for Your Project
Before printing, consider the purpose of your project. A subtle pattern may be better suited for a minimalist design, while a bold pattern could work well for a more dynamic layout. Always preview the paper in the context of your design to ensure it complements the overall aesthetic.
2. Print with High-Quality Settings
Since these papers are available in 300 DPI format, it's important to print them using high-quality settings. This ensures that the colors remain vibrant and the details are clear. If you're printing at home, make sure your printer is calibrated for the best results.
3. Combine with Other Elements
Don’t be afraid to layer these papers with other design elements. You can place text over the pattern, add embellishments, or even cut the paper into shapes to create unique effects. Experimenting with different combinations can lead to surprising and beautiful outcomes.
